Identification, Selection, and Use of Southern Plants: For ...
Deciduous Tree or Shrub Native of China and introduced into this country in the
1780s, the crape myrtle is unrivaled among Southern small-flowering trees in
ease of culture, length of bloom, interesting trunks, and many other features.
Neil G. Odenwald, James R. Turner, 2006
